Yes, that’s possible, just implemented that in the beta. I haven’t been able to write the manual just yet because of that, but I’ll explain it here.
Add [paytium_links /] to your form as in the below example, and then add the parameters in the URL with exactly the same name as the labels. Don’t use a hash # in the labels.
See:
https://www.paytium.nl/handleiding/links/In English that page says:
You can fill fields in a form automatically with information and start paying immediately. This is done with a URL. In the URL, you enter the names of the fields (exact) and with an = sign you add the value you want to fill in the field.
Do not use hash # in your labels, because this does not work in a URL.
